Weather in January

January, the same as December, is an extremely cold winter month in Timmins, Canada, with an average temperature fluctuating between -19.1°C (-2.4°F) and -10.7°C (12.7°F).

Temperature

January, recording an average high temperature of -10.7°C (12.7°F) and a low temperature of -19.1°C (-2.4°F), is Timmins's coldest month.

Humidity

January and February, with an average relative humidity of 94%, are the most humid months in Timmins.

Rainfall

January is the month with the least rainfall in Timmins, Canada. Rain falls for 1.6 days and accumulates 30mm (1.18") of precipitation.

Snowfall

January through June, September through December are months with snowfall in Timmins. In January, it is snowing for 23.7 days. Throughout January, 237mm (9.33") of snow is accumulated. In Timmins, during the entire year, snow falls for 142.2 days and aggregates up to 1653mm (65.08") of snow.

Daylight

The average length of the day in January in Timmins is 8h and 51min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 8:16 am and sunset at 4:40 pm. On the last day of January, sunrise is at 7:55 am and sunset at 5:21 pm EST.

Sunshine

January and February, with an average of 1.1h of sunshine, are months with the least sunshine in Timmins.

UV index

The months with the lowest UV index are January through March, October through December, with an average maximum UV index of 1. A UV Index estimate of 2, and below, represents a minimal health hazard from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for ordinary individuals.
Note: The UV index of 1 in January translates into these instructions:
Extended time in the sun generally does not harm most, but those with sensitive skin, infants, and children should always be protected. Midday Sun has the strongest UV rays, making it crucial to limit exposure and find shade. Opt for tightly woven and loose clothing to enhance protection from the Sun. Alert! The snow's reflection can amplify the UV radiation of the Sun nearly twice.
